MATTER OF SERRA v. SELSKY


223 A.D.2d 845 (1996)

636 N.Y.S.2d 462

In the Matter of Victor Serra, Petitioner, v. Donald Selsky, as Director of Inmate Disciplinary Program, State of New York Department of Correctional Services, et al., Respondents

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Third Department.

January 11, 1996


Peters, J.

As a result of a letter thought to have been written by petitioner, he became the target of an investigation for gang-related activity and the subject of a disciplinary report for engaging in unauthorized organizational activities. Petitioner commenced this proceeding challenging the determination finding him guilty of unauthorized organizational activities for his gang-related activity with the Latin Kings.
